Pink Is In Hospital

by Music-News.com on June 1, 2012

in News

Pink was hospitalised on Thursday.

The 32-year-old singer took to her Twitter account to tell followers she had been feeling under the weather. Despite being admitted for stomach flu, Pink was remarkably upbeat. She shared a photograph through her Instagram account which showed her smiling as she lay in a hospital bed with an IV drip in her arm.

Pink explained that her mother’s medical background means she is comfortable in hospitals. She quipped that the pain medication she had been given had also brightened her mood.

“Maybe it”s cause my mom was an ER nurse all my life- but throw me in a gown and a hook me up to an IV- and I”m a happy girl,’ she wrote. “Stomach flu sucks but morphine doesn”t (sic).”

Pink then added an update to her health status.

She thanked fans for their well-wishes, before hinting she might not be suffering from stomach flu at all.

‘Thanks for all the get well wishes. And no-they don”t give morphine for flu. I might have ulcers again. Because I care too much. It”s a gift (sic),’ she tweeted.

Meanwhile, another star was also receiving hospital treatment on Thursday.

Actress-and-talk show host Chelsea Handler underwent knee surgery. She also happily posed for a photograph, which was posted on Facebook.

“This is me post-surgery. Fortune Feimster will be filling in as the host on tonight”s show with more photos of me and my knee making a quick recovery. Pls support her (sic),” she said in a message to accompany the picture.
